It’s showtime

When a student commits to raising livestock, their school day doesn’t start at 8:30 in the morning and end at 3:00 in the afternoon. Instead it often involves early mornings and late evenings filled with feeding, caring for and training their animals. For dozens of students across the county, these extended hours are their way of life, and later this week all of their hard work will be on display at the Carter County Junior Livestock Show.

Supreme Court to review Native American child adoption law

WASHINGTON – The Supreme Court agreed to review a case involving a federal law that gives Native Americans preference in adoptions of Native children. The high court said Monday it would take the case that presents the most significant legal challenges to the Indian Child Welfare Act since it was passed in 1978.

Russian forces shell Ukraine’s No. 2 city, menace Kyiv

KYIV, Ukraine – Russian forces shelled Ukraine’s second-largest city on Monday, rocking a residential neighborhood, and closed in on the capital, Kyiv, in a 17-mile convoy of hundreds of tanks and other vehicles, as talks aimed at stopping the fighting yielded only an agreement to keep talking.

Biden prepared to address nation

WASHINGTON – President Joe Biden will deliver his first State of the Union address Tuesday to a nation eager to move on from the deadly coronavirus pandemic but facing worries over inflation and conflict with Russia.
